601.43 Examinations and alternatives.
(1)Power to examine.
(a)Insurers, other licensees and other persons subject to regulation. Whenever the commissioner deems it necessary in order to inform himself or herself about any matter related to the enforcement of chs. 600 to 647 , the commissioner may examine the affairs and condition of any licensee, registrant, or permittee under chs. 600 to 647 or applicant for a license, registration, or permit, of any person or organization of persons doing or in process of organizing to do an insurance business in this state, of any public adjuster, as defined in s. 629.01
(5), and of any advisory organization serving any of the foregoing in this state.
